  • Big Bloke with Big Jokes

    Stevie Parker

    My Birthday Production, in conjunction with Darth Vader Felt My, Presents

    Expect something old, something new, something borrowed, nothing (ish) blue. AND NOT ONLY THAT a WORLD RECORD ATTEMPT of 1001 Jokes (in Order) in 55 minutes will be Attempted at Each Show. This is a Work in Progress and not a Contractual Binding Legal Commitment that it will be achieved on the night.

    1001 in binary is 9. So that’s just 9 jokes!!! But fear not, my attempt will be non binary!! So, will hope to get to 28 jokes (Base 3 at least!!!).

    This event has never been reviewed by anyone (except for the Mrs who said it was Rubbish!!!), so you could be the first and who knows also witness the premiere of the successful World Record Attempt.

    I’ve been telling stories and ‘Dad’ Jokes ever since I can remember. In fact, ever since Dad jokes were just Toddler jokes. Now, however, my jokes are 'Full Groan' and my stories are too. I will reference my childhood and memory constantly throughout the Show. Coincidentally, my first ever memory was being dragged to the optician by my dad, everything before that was a blur!!

    I started out for real after going down proper with the ‘Comedy bug’ a couple of years ago. I did open Mics wherever I could and often did slots at Music sessions just to gain experience and time on stage. These can be the most difficult ones of all when a blank face looks up at you from the front row thinking... ’this isn’t music”!! I often refer this experience to like running with weights on but helped immensely in my development.

    Since then, I have 2 Open Mic (Comedy Only) Nights in Leeds that have been going for well over a year. I thought it was time to thrust myself without fear into other parts of the Country. And what a place to kick off with.
